CCPA/CPRA Compliance Framework
Consumer Rights Implementation
Right to Know (CCPA Section 1798.100)
Data Collection Notice: Clear disclosure of personal information categories collected
Source Disclosure: Identification of sources from which data is collected
Purpose Limitation: Specific business purposes for data collection documented
Data Categories: Detailed inventory of personal information categories processed
Third Party Sharing: Disclosure of data sharing with third parties and purposes
Retention Periods: Specific retention periods for each data category documented
Right to Delete (CCPA Section 1798.105)
Deletion Mechanisms: User-initiated deletion requests through multiple channels
Verification Process: Identity verification for deletion requests
Complete Deletion: Removal from all systems, backups, and third-party integrations
Deletion Exceptions: Limited exceptions properly documented and justified
Confirmation Process: Confirmation of successful deletion to consumer
Timeline Compliance: Deletion completed within 45 days (extendable to 90 days)
Right to Correct (CPRA Addition)
Correction Mechanisms: User interface for requesting data corrections
Verification Process: Identity verification for correction requests
Data Accuracy: Processes to maintain and verify data accuracy
Correction Propagation: Updates shared with third parties who received data
Timeline Compliance: Corrections completed within 45 days
Right to Opt-Out (CCPA Section 1798.120)
Sale Opt-Out: Clear "Do Not Sell My Personal Information" mechanism
Sharing Opt-Out: CPRA addition for targeted advertising opt-out
Opt-Out Methods: Multiple methods to submit opt-out requests
Global Privacy Control: Respect for GPC signals from browsers/devices
Third Party Notification: Notify third parties of consumer opt-out status
Opt-Out Verification: No verification required for opt-out requests
Right to Portability (CCPA Section 1798.100)
Data Export: Machine-readable format for data portability
Structured Data: JSON, CSV, or XML format for exported data
Complete Export: All personal information in a readily usable format
Metadata Inclusion: Include dates, sources, and categories in export
Secure Transfer: Encrypted transmission of exported data
CPRA Enhanced Requirements
Sensitive Personal Information Protections
SPI Categories: Precise geolocation, racial/ethnic origin, religious beliefs, genetic data, biometric data, health data, sexual orientation, union membership
Limited Use: SPI only used for disclosed purposes
Opt-Out Rights: Right to limit use of sensitive personal information
Enhanced Security: Additional security measures for SPI processing
Retention Limits: Shorter retention periods for sensitive data
Risk Assessment and Data Minimization
Privacy Impact Assessments: Regular PIAs for high-risk processing activities
Data Minimization: Collect only necessary data for stated purposes
Purpose Limitation: Data used only for original collection purposes
Proportionality: Processing proportional to risks and benefits
Regular Review: Periodic review of data processing necessity
